Late last night Nintendo finally released the long awaited June update. This update adds new functionality to the Nintendo 3DS, including the ability to transfer DSiWare bring over your DSiWare titles,  and the ability to browse the web. Although from what I’ve used of the web browser, it’s nothing to get excited about.

 

More importantly, the Nintendo 3DS’ digital download service, the eShop, launched. Until early July you get a free copy of Excite Bike optimized for the Nintendo 3DS’ 3D visuals and its wide screen display. Pokédex 3D is also available for free.  Of course, if you’re looking to spend a little cash you can go with one of the Virtual Console releases including Radar Mission, Alleyway, and the classic Super Mario Land.  And finally, you get full access to almost the entirety of DSiWare’s library. A fantastic opportunity for those who missed out on the DSi the first time around.

 

The Nintendo 3DS eShop will be updated on Thursdays in North America, separating it from the usual DSiWare, WiiWare, and Wii Virtual Console’s Monday updates. Let’s hope we start getting some of those great Virtual Console releases that have already hit Japan, like Kirby’s Adventure and Mega Man: Dr Wily’s Revenge.
